Introduction to products:?
The process of drying poly aluminum chloride by centrifugal sprayer is as following: mother liquor of poly aluminum chloride is atomized into minimal for fog drip by centrifugal atomizer at the top of drying tower, and then granular products can be formed after drip being dried.?

Main indexes of poly aluminum chloride:?
Al2O3:?during the spray drying process, the centrifuge evenly sprays mother liquor in the drying tower. Therefore, the content of Al2O3 being stable and uniform can be easily controlled within the index range, as a result, it strengthens adsorption capacity of colloidal particles and achieves effects of coacervation and flocculation. Other drying methods don’t bear the above advantages.
Alkalized degree:When implementing water treatment, alkalized degree (polymerization degree) directly influences the purification effect, so we adopt spray drying process for raising the polymerization degree of products on the basis of keeping the original activity of mother liquor, meanwhile, we are able to duly adjust the alkalized degree in conformity with different water quality. However, using tumble drying method easily damaged polymerization degree leading to small alkalized degree separation, which is only available for a few water qualities.
Water-in soluble:?we can keep solid water-insoluble m/m below 0.3% and liquid water-insoluble below 0.1% applying plate and frame filter press technology to guarantee use’s pipes unobstructed and lift utilization rate of drugs, but using natural precipitation method can not realize the above purposes.

The national standard for?poly aluminum chloride(GB15892-2003?)
Name of the index |
Index | |||||
| Grade I | Grade II | |||||
| Liquid | Solid | Liquid | Solid | |||
| Top quality | First class | Top quality | First class | Top quality | First class | |
| Al2O3 (m/m): % / | 10.0 | 30.0 | 28 | 10.0 | 27.0 | |
| Alkalized degree:% | 40-85 | 40-90 | ||||
| Water-insoluble (m/m): % ≤ | 0.1 | 0.3 | 0.3 | 1.0 | 0.5 | 1.5 |
| Ammonium Nitrogen (m/m): % ≤ | 0.01 | 0.01 | —— | —— | ||
| As (m/m): % ≤ | 0.0001 | 0.0002 | —— | —— | ||
| Pb (m/m): % ≤ | 0.0005 | 0.001 | —— | —— | ||
| Cd (m/m): % ≤ | 0.0001 | 0.0002 | —— | —— | ||
| Hg (m/m): % ≤ | 0.00001 | 0.00001 | —— | —— | ||
| Cr+6 (m/m): % ≤ | 0.0005 | 0.0005 | —— | —— | ||
| Note: The impurities m/m of liquid products such as Ammonium Nitrogen, As, Pb, Cd, Hg, Cr+6 and so on is calculated according to 10.0% of Al2O3. The indexes of Grade I products at the table 1 are mandatory, while these of Grade II are recommended. | ||||||
